Output 3fbaa3bf09b60c6241167477dfd10a91164cfcef13b52993a1c288c1910553cc:127

value
72888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4a09b781e0ec677598c13d446378d3156f06d28 OP_EQUAL
address
3NXtPULBxyNqCGs4iCKHfJ6CFSYiMKbzWb
transaction
3fbaa3bf09b60c6241167477dfd10a91164cfcef13b52993a1c288c1910553cc
confirmations
69142
spent
false

1 Sat Range